This utility model discloses a precision stamping system for an electric bicycle fork mounting plate, including a forming mechanism and a punching mechanism. Each mechanism has a rotating component and a lifting mechanism for driving the rotating component to rise and fall on adjacent sides. A lateral extension is provided on one side of the rotating component, and an electromagnet is fixedly connected to the end of the lateral extension away from the rotating component. The two rotating components can rotate until the two electromagnets are vertically aligned. The lateral extension on the forming mechanism side is also equipped with a rotary drive device that drives the electromagnet on it to flip up and down, so that when the two electromagnets are vertically aligned, they flip so that the magnetic surfaces of the two electromagnets face each other. This utility model allows a single person to continuously complete the stamping and punching processes with low labor intensity, effectively improving processing efficiency.

[0002] The flat fork mounting plate of electric bicycles is usually made of metal stamping. During processing, after stamping, multiple punching is required. Usually, the two processes are carried out separately by two workers operating the forming stamping machine and the punching stamping machine respectively. Both processes require manual loading and unloading by workers, which requires a large amount of manpower, high labor intensity, and low work efficiency. Summary of the Invention

[0015] As attached Figure 1-2The precision stamping system for the electric bicycle flat fork mounting plate includes a forming mechanism 1 and a punching mechanism 2. A rotating component 3 and a lifting mechanism 4 for driving the rotating component 3 to rise and fall are provided on adjacent sides of both. A lateral extension is provided on one side of the rotating component 3, and an electromagnet 5 is fixedly connected to the end of the lateral extension away from the rotating component 3. The two rotating components 3 can rotate until the two electromagnets 5 are vertically aligned. The lateral extension on the forming mechanism 1 side is also provided with a rotary drive device 6 that drives the electromagnets 5 on it to flip vertically, so that when the two electromagnets 5 are vertically aligned, they flip so that the magnetic surfaces of the two electromagnets 5 face each other vertically. Workers simply feed the pre-cut sheet material to the forming mechanism. After stamping, the electromagnet 5 on the forming mechanism 1 picks up the formed sheet, and the corresponding lifting mechanism 4 drives the corresponding rotating component 3 to rise, lifting the sheet away from the lower die of the forming mold to a certain height. Then, the rotating component 3 rotates, causing the sheet to move towards the punching mechanism 2. During the rotation, the rotary drive device 6 controls the electromagnet to flip until the sheet is on the upper side. At the same time, the rotating component 3 on the punching mechanism 2 also drives its electromagnet 5 to rotate to meet the electromagnet that has attracted the sheet. When the two electromagnets are brought close together and aligned vertically, the formed sheet is positioned between them. By moving the upper electromagnet 5 down to contact the sheet and energizing it while de-energizing the lower electromagnet, the sheet is attracted to the upper electromagnet. The rotating component 3 on the punching mechanism 2 then aligns the sheet with the lower die of the punching mold during rotation. The feeding action relative to the punching mechanism 2 is automatically completed by moving the sheet into position and de-energizing the electromagnet. After punching, the worker can remove the flat fork mounting plate. The worker only needs to feed the sheet into the forming mechanism and unload it into the punching mechanism. The intermediate process is completed by two magnetic attraction mechanisms, reducing the number of workers required. Furthermore, the transfer of the semi-finished sheet from the forming mechanism 1 to the punching mechanism 2 is accomplished by the fixed-point exchange attraction of the two electromagnets, making the positioning of the semi-finished sheet relative to the lower punching die more precise and faster, eliminating the need for manual adjustment, ensuring forming quality, and effectively improving work efficiency.

[0016] The rotation shaft of the rotary drive device 6 is connected to the corresponding electromagnet 5 via a crossbar 61. The crossbar is also equipped with a touch switch 51 that controls the on / off state of the electromagnet 5, and the electromagnet 5 and the touch switch 51 are fixedly connected to the same side of the crossbar 61. The lower mold of the molding mechanism 1 is equipped with a trigger. When the electromagnet 5 rotates to be vertically aligned with the lower mold of the molding mechanism 1, the rotary drive device 6 descends, and during the descent, it drives the touch switch to strike the trigger. Each touch of the contact switch toggles the on / off state of the electromagnet, while the rotating component 3 is controlled by the controller to perform regular fixed-point rotation. For example, after the forming mechanism completes one stamping, the rotating component on its side drives the electromagnet, which is in a de-energized state, to rotate to the upper side of the semi-finished material sheet. By moving down and approaching the material sheet, and when it approaches the lower mold, the collision between the trigger and the contact switch energizes the electromagnet. At this time, the electromagnet has been pressed against the surface of the material sheet, achieving a stable fixed-point adsorption and completing the material picking operation. Then, through a series of lifting, horizontal rotation, and vertical flipping, the handover operation with the electromagnet on the other side is completed.

[0017] The lateral extension on the molding mechanism 1 side is a short rotating arm 11. An inductive switch for controlling the rotation of the rotary drive device 6 is provided on the bottom side of the short rotating arm 11. Inductive trigger elements are provided on both sides of the rotating component 3 where the short rotating arm 11 is located. During the relative rotation of the two electromagnets 5, as they approach or move away from each other, the inductive switch sweeps across the two inductive trigger elements. The inductive switch and inductive trigger elements are photoelectric switches. The transmitter and receiver are installed as the inductive switch and inductive trigger elements, respectively. When the transmitter sweeps across a receiver, it controls the electromagnet to rotate 180° longitudinally, so that when corresponding to the lower mold, the magnetic attraction surface faces down, and when intersecting with another electromagnet, the magnetic attraction surface faces up.

[0018] The transverse extension on side 2 of the punching mechanism is a long rotating arm 21. The end of the long rotating arm 21 is equipped with a contact switch 51 that controls the energization of its own electromagnet 5. When the magnetic surfaces of the two electromagnets 5 are facing each other, the two contact switches 51 are also facing each other. During the descent of the long rotating arm 21, it causes the contact switch 51 on it to collide with the contact switch 51 on the crossbar. When the two contact switches 51 collide, the two electromagnets 5 clamp the stamped sheet from top to bottom. Since the electromagnet on side 1 of the forming mechanism and its contact switch are located on the same side of the crossbar 61, when the corresponding electromagnet flips to face upwards, its contact switch also faces upwards. Therefore, when the electromagnet on the other side moves down to contact the semi-finished sheet, the two contact switches collide, causing the lower electromagnet to de-energize and the upper electromagnet to energize. Furthermore, the sheet is first clamped by the two electromagnets before being exchanged and attracted, ensuring that the sheet will not fall off and the attraction position will not shift during this process, thus guaranteeing accurate positioning when feeding material to the punching mechanism.

[0019] The lower die of the punching mechanism 2 is equipped with a trigger. When the electromagnet 5 on the long rotating arm 21 rotates to align with the lower die of the punching mechanism 2, the long rotating arm 21 descends, and during the descent, the contact switch 51 at its end strikes the trigger. Similarly to the forming mechanism 1, after the semi-finished material sheet is moved to align with the lower die, it is gradually lowered until it matches the lower die. When it is in position, the contact switch 51 strikes the trigger on the lower die, de-energizing the electromagnet and completing the loading. After the electromagnet is removed by the rotating component, the punching operation can begin.

[0020] A loading and unloading storage rack 7 is provided on one side of the rotating component 3 beside the forming mechanism 1, and a unloading storage rack 8 is provided on one side of the rotating component 3 beside the punching mechanism 2. By setting the loading and unloading storage racks on the horizontal rotation trajectories of the two electromagnets respectively, the loading action relative to the forming mechanism 1 and the unloading action relative to the punching mechanism can be further replaced by workers, further reducing the labor intensity of workers. The suction and release actions of the electromagnets on the loading and unloading storage racks can also be triggered by triggers, and the triggers on the loading and unloading storage racks can be set to automatically rise and fall with the height of the material pile, so that the electromagnets are triggered to switch on and off just when they are pressed against the upper part of the material pile, thereby achieving stable fixed-point suction of material pieces and stable fixed-point unloading. The loading and unloading storage racks can be set side by side on the same side for easy operation by workers.
